Concrete Laborer
About the Role
We are seeking construction laborers with experience in lagging, underpinning, grout mixing, and other support of excavation tasks. This role involves physical labor at construction sites to assist with these operations.
Responsibilities
- Hand digging and backfilling for installation of lagging or underpinning
- Mixing grout
- Tieback fabrication
- Drilling assistance
- Digging trenches
- Cleaning up debris
- Using power and air tools as necessary
- Other duties associated with the support of excavation
